
Viridian Artists
Art galleryViridian Artists is an artist-owned gallery in Chelsea, Manhattan, tracing its roots to a collective formed on Long Island in the 1960s that became one of SoHo's early artist-run galleries, then spent 25 years on West 57th Street before relocating to Chelsea just before September 11, 2001. Unlike a cooperative where members run their own shows, Viridian's professional staff handles exhibition logistics for its represented artists, who are admitted through peer review and contribute dues toward the gallery's operating costs. The roster includes emerging and established artists from across the United States and abroad, including Japan, France, and Korea, with programming that features juried and invitational group exhibitions and a young artist's program.
